Delete a Flow

Delete a flow from a geometry or from the project entirely.

Remove a flow from the selected geometry

To delete a flow from a geometry, click the X next to the flow name in the Flow Controls section of the properties palette.

This removed the flow from the selected geometry, but leave the flow in the project for use on other geometries.

Delete a flow from the project

To delete a flow from a project, open the flow builder.

Select the flow you want to delete from the dropdown.

Then, click the bin icon.

If the flow is applied to geometries, you will be prompted to confirm.

Once the flow is deleted, the flow will be removed from the Flow Controls section of any geometries, and it will no longer appear in the selection dropdown in the flow builder.

Deleting a flow cannot be undone!

Purge Unused Flows

If you have a lot of flows in a project, but you don't need any that aren't assigned to geometries, you can use the "Delete Unused Flows" command to clean up the list.

Tap spacebar. The command line appears.

Search Delete Unused Flows

Select Delete Unused Flows

You will be asked to confirm.

All unused flows will be removed.

Deleting unused flows cannot be undone!
